Oregon unveils new, high-tech uniforms

Ducks will have 80 uniform combination options

EUGENE, Ore. - The University of Oregon football team will once again be pushing the boundaries of athletic fashion. Oregon has made headlines with cutting-edge uniform designs and combinations for the past decade, and 2009 will be no exception.

In conjunction with Nike, the Ducks rolled out their fifth major uniform change since 1996 and first since 2006, according to ESPN.com .

Incorporating various colors including kelly green, yellow, white, black and silver, the new models give the Ducks 80 different combinations of jersey, pants and helmet. The 2006 versions actually had 384 possible game-day combinations .

The uniforms are not only stylish (depending on who you ask), but they are also practical. Between the uniforms, pads and details like titanium d-rings on the belts, the new models reportedly reduce the total weight of the uniforms by 25 percent.
